你查询的IP:[159.226.2.228]  地理位置:中国–北京–北京中国科学院计算机网络信息中心

最新查询116.1.3.218 123.52.46.7 121.4.138.116 121.48.82.72 116.76.157.10 220.231.15.96 219.72.247.22 58.128.106.49 122.64.10.183 159.226.2.228 117.60.54.121 220.231.11.172 219.242.67.30 210.32.97.115 202.92.252.53 210.79.224.7 120.48.56.57 222.248.191.167 202.38.184.186 202.63.248.95 58.14.189.247 60.55.173.121 116.56.181.162 122.240.8.90 124.14.209.104 120.246.235.118 222.160.48.196 203.91.32.194 210.72.142.54 120.52.162.166 220.234.106.15